Which role creates and maintains the tour budget, receives payments from venues, and files state and federal taxes?

Explanation:
The key idea is who is responsible for the financial backbone of a tour. The business manager handles money flows, budgeting, and regulatory compliance for the artist’s or group’s finances. They create and maintain the tour budget, track income and expenses, and coordinate payments received from venues. They also oversee tax obligations, typically working with a CPA to file state and federal taxes and ensure proper accounting practices. The promoter focuses on securing shows and marketing, the tour/road manager handles day-to-day logistics, and the tech deals with gear, so the financial and tax responsibilities fit best with the business manager.
